Abstract
Gives practical guidance for planners and developers, ensuring archaeological issues are considered at all stages of a project. Highlights common problems, how to manage risks, the planning process and legal requirements, mitigation and provides checklists. Concentrates on buried archaeological remains, though above ground monuments, existing buildings, coastal/marine archaeology and portable objects are mentioned.

Publisher History
CIRIA was formerly known as the Construction Industry Research and Information Association. They are a member-based research and information organisation who publish reports and technical papers covering building and civil engineering as well as transport and utilities infrastructure.
